Hello all:
If I were to use GATK's local realigner outside of GATK pipeline, eg: BWA -> GATK's Local Realigner -> SAMTools then will I have any extra problems because I use non-GATK modules upstream or downstream of realignment? Thanks, Nik |

No problem - in fact, the latest version of SAMtools variant-calling workflow uses GATK's realigner and base recalibrator.
